Open Remote behind an Airport?

I recently relocated my guitar shop, run exclusively on the FM db I built about 4 years ago. When we went to 2 Macs about a year ago, we hosted on one, and logged in wirelessly with the laptop using "Open Remote". I've also logged into a static IP computer using the same function. But my shop is now 10 miles from my house, and I'd like to log into the shop network from home using Open Remote, but that network is behind an Airport, and I just can't see any of the computers there, even knowing the IP. Any suggestions?

Your network at work is more than likely (should be) behind a firewall. You could open the filemaker ports to allow connection through the firewall. If you have a static IP address on your home computer, and your network firewall will support it, you can setup your firewall to accept connections from the specific IP address, just like it is part of the local network. The ports are 2399 and 5003.

Another option would be to setup a VPN connection between home and your work network - if your netwrok will support it, which would require purchasing some VPN software.
